What we do with the waste
Each week we receive tonnes of donations, only one third of which are suitable to be sold within the shops.
So what happens to the rest?
Each week we send 750kg (3/4 of a tonne) of rags (unsaleable clothes, shoes, handbags and soft toys) to be recycled via a registered merchant.
Books, coathangers, electrical items, paper, cardboard, DVDs, CDs, videos and some plastics and metals which we are unable to sell are taken by another merchant. Although they do not pay us for the items they take, they do collect and recycle them all.
The remaining waste is put into our green bins for collection by the local council. We are working hard to keep this proportion of our waste to a minimum, and are currently sourcing additional recycling collectors for the remaining waste.
